Garforth Loop
A road cycling route starting from Leeds
Experience the rural beauty of West Yorkshire on this scenic 53-km road cycling route from Leeds to Garforth

This road cycling route covers a distance of 53 kilometers with a total ascent of 410 meters. The ride takes you from Leeds to Garforth and back, passing through picturesque villages and rural landscapes. The route includes highlights such as Shadwell, known for its well-preserved historic buildings, and Kirkstall, home to a stunning medieval abbey. Suitable for well-trained amateur cyclists, this route offers a mix of flat and hilly sections, providing both a physical challenge and scenic enjoyment. Enjoy the peaceful beauty of the West Yorkshire countryside as you pedal along country lanes.

Leeds, situated in West Yorkshire, United Kingdom, is a vibrant city that offers excellent cycling opportunities. The city boasts a cycling-friendly infrastructure with dedicated cycle lanes and paths, making it easy and safe to navigate. Cyclists can explore Leeds' many attractions, including stunning parks, green spaces, and vibrant neighborhoods. A popular cycling spot near the city is Otley Chevin, which provides scenic routes and breathtaking views along the way.
